there are a number of flashes that would be a lot cheaper and even very cheap.
check out flashes from Vivitar, Yongnuo, Lumopro, Mets .. you don't need super-expensive flashes sporting a TTL system you won't use. all you need is a manual flash with variable power output.. I set myself on a pair of Yongnuo YN 560 as it is both powerful, lots of possibilities (optical slave function, long zoom...) and very cheap..
